Don't Act Hastily


"Therefore thus says the Lord GOD: 'Behold, I lay in Zion a stone for a foundation, a tried stone, a precious cornerstone, a sure foundation; whoever believes will not act hastily." - Isaiah 28:16 NKJV

If you are facing a decision of some sort right now, I have a word from the Lord for you today. It's Isaiah 28:16 (NKJV), which says: "Whoever believes will not act hastily." In other words, when our trust is truly in God, the way it's supposed to be, we will not make a move without seeking His direction, wisdom, and help. We will take the time to pause, to get still in our hearts and minds, and to seek the Lord through focused prayer and Scripture reading. A trusting soul will believe that God really does know best, and that He always wants what is best for us.

Sometimes when we're facing circumstances that trouble us, we can be tempted to take matters into our own hands, instead of waiting on God and following the leadership of His Spirit. This strategy can actually make matters worse, and can even create a new set of problems that will leave us with feelings of regret in the long run.

Years ago, when my husband's old car died suddenly, we knew that we had to replace it quickly, so we began searching used car lots in our area. We found what we thought was the perfect car, but the price was higher than we could afford. When my husband asked the salesman if he could come down in price, the man flatly refused. As we began leaving the car lot, the salesman stopped us and said, "If you will buy this car right now, I will throw in the warranty for free!" Joe couldn't resist the offer, and he said without thinking, "You've got a deal!" The very first day that my husband was driving his new car to work, the engine blew up. He was furious, because he was sure that we had been swindled. But he knew that it would have been much worse if we didn't have the warranty on the car, which helped to pay for most of the repair expenses. To this day, Joe and I talk about this incident and its costliness when we are tempted to make a hasty decision. If we had only paused and prayed ahead of time, we never would have purchased that "lemon" of a car.

The truth is that it can be downright dangerous for us to try to hurry up God's plans for us, or to try to make something happen that is out of His perfect will or timing. Responding to situations like this only proves that we believe that we know better than God what is best for us. It is the Lord's will for us to seek His wisdom and guidance in every situation. The Bible tells us: "The Lord says, 'I will guide you along the best pathway for your life. I will advise you and watch over you. Do not be like a senseless horse or mule that needs a bit and bridle to keep it under control.'" (Psalm 32:8-9 NLT) This promise tells us two important things: first, that God longs to lead us into His best plans for our lives; and second, that He requires our cooperation. In order to receive God's best, we must be sensitive and obedient to His Spirit's leading at all times. Prayer and meditation upon God's Word can help us to discern the Lord's voice.

You can't even begin to imagine what the Lord has planned for you, if you will only refuse to act hastily today. Let this promise from His Word sustain and encourage you: "For from of old no one has heard nor perceived by the ear, nor has the eye seen a God besides You, Who works and shows Himself active on behalf of him who [earnestly] waits for Him"! (Isaiah 64:4 AMP)

Prayer: Lord, I long to receive Your best in every situation and circumstance. Please teach me how to do that. Give me the patience and faith I need to wait when You want me to wait, and to act when You want me to act. Help me to never rush ahead of You, or to lag behind. Remind me often that when I refuse to follow Your lead, I can miss out on Your greatest plans, rewards, and opportunities. Thank You that as I put my trust in You, and wait upon Your leadership, You will bless me, use me, and promote me in extraordinary ways!
